Belgium Helps Build First Family Doctor Center in Hanoi

The French-speaking community of Brussels and Liege University of Belgium have assisted a project to build a family doctor center in Hanoi, the Suc Khoe & Doi Song newspaper reported Thursday. The project, the first of its kind in northern Vietnam, will be implemented by a hospital under the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development. The center helps reduce the overload of big hospitals and improve healthcare services, the newspaper added. Professor Didier from the Liege University said that the model of the family doctor was carried out successfully in Belgium and development countries.
